[REQUEST] Genetics for skins.

Open Tarnia919 opened this issue 4 years ago • 2 comments

Years ago, I remember watching someone playing with this mod, and showing his child, whose skin was a mix between the player´s and his wife´s skins. However, in the version I´m playing - 5.3.1, for 1.12.x - I´ve tried having children to see if this could happen, but every child just has a random skin that doesn´t fit when you look at the parents. It is odd that two villagers of color can have a white child. Besides, I love genetics in videogames, and I´d love to see my children inhereting things from my spouse and I.

I don´t know if this would be to hard, or even impossible, to do, but I´d personally love it. Still, I´m learning how to make skins and I know how to place them inside the game, so, until then, I can always make my children´s appearences. Thanks for reading!

This would be near impossible without any machine learning algorithms to generate skins for you. Can you link the video you watched? Perhaps the video creators did some things behind the scene such as edit the baby skin to make it look like there were genetics.

Al through still quite some work, you can define 2-3 different genes (color, ...) resulting in samples^3 different textures, then interpolate and slightly randomize the result. Therefore, it's possible to implement, but requires more interest first.
